Ticket: Staging env misconfigured for Siftgate bloom filter

The bloom layer in front of the Pellet KV store is rejecting all lookups in staging because the env file was copied from the dev template without credentials. False-positive tuning values are fine; only the auth line is missing. To unblock the weekly demo, the Pellet admission secret must be set on the following line.

env line for yaguf-fajop: LEDGER_TOKEN13=fb08984397349

## Ownership

Sensor drift in the Fernbox greenhouse controller remains a known issue. Humidity probes skew +3% after ~40 days; recalibration job runs nightly but misses probes offline during the window. Drift detection logic lives in `driftwatch/`. Do not patch thresholds without review. All drift-related changes, escalations, and calibration overrides route through the module owner named below.

account owner for faduf-fafog: Jorax Quenox Tamael

### Digest Scheduling API

The Mailwright digest scheduler accepts batch jobs via POST to /v2/digests with a cron expression and recipient segment. Jobs are idempotent per segment per window; duplicate submissions return the existing job ID. If digests stall, check the scheduler heartbeat endpoint before requeueing anything, since requeues during a paused worker will double-send once it resumes. All endpoints require the internal scheduler credential, so authenticate with the key below.

service key, fawip-bajef: kto11_Qt5wZK9vdNC